On-the-job phlebotomy training in Shepherd Michigan comprises supervised practical experience drawing blood, disposing of biohazardous substances, and basic laboratory procedures. Hands on phlebotomy training is, in addition, intensely safety-centered, since workers risk frequent exposure to blood-borne illnesses--including Hepatitis and HIV. Within the rapidly expanding health care sector, employment of clinical laboratory technicians (which includes phlebotomists) is expected to increase 14 percent from 2006 to 2016--faster compared to the average for all occupations. The increase in new jobs is due to increasing population and also the development of new lab tests.
